In tight areas (like the scalp) when excising benign lesions, I often recommend serial excision. It involves multiple procedures to excise the lesion, the advantage being that it minimizes the scar. Perhaps discuss this option with your PS in order to minimize any bald patch from the scar.
Nevus sebaceous will continue to grow, so I would recommend surgical excision. The shape of the nevus is more vertically oriented. If the nevus is excised in a vertical direction, then you are at risk of the hair parting away from the scar, which will make it noticeable. If the nevus is excised transversely, then you have a better chance for the scar to be covered by the hair (since your hair would fall over the scar). This usually is covered by insurance. Excision is the treatment of choice. This will depend on the scalp mobility. Some patients need only one session - others two. The scar line will be minimal as hair will cover it up. Dr Davin Lim.
